#795abd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#795abd is composed of 47.5% red, 35.3%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36% cyan, 52.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 258.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 54.7%. #795abd color hex could be obtained by blending #f2b4ff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#795abd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#795abd has RGB values of R:121, G:90,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 7953085.

Hex triplet 795abd #795abd
RGB Decimal 121, 90, 189 rgb(121,90,189)
RGB Percent 47.5, 35.3, 74.1 rgb(47.5%,35.3%,74.1%)
CMYK 36, 52, 0, 26
HSL 258.8°, 42.9, 54.7 hsl(258.8,42.9%,54.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 258.8°, 52.4, 74.1
Web Safe 6666cc #6666cc
CIE-LAB 45.704, 34.979, -47.867
XYZ 20.725, 15.051, 49.955
xyY 0.242, 0.176, 15.051
CIE-LCH 45.704, 59.285, 306.158
CIE-LUV 45.704, 6.723, -75.203
Hunter-Lab 38.796, 27.463, -49.186
Binary 01111001, 01011010, 10111101

Shades and Tints of #795abd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#795abd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8691 is the less saturated color, while #621cfb is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#795abd is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#6f6f6f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#716b7f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#3d70cc Protanopia 1% of men
  • #3d74b9 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#6e747c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#5268c6 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#536bba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#726a94 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
